Hello!
I was wandering how can I calculate if a steal is profitable from a late position with stacks 10-15 blinds.
When to min-raise, shove, or fold?
And what software do you use mostly for this so you can get an accurate result?

With ante in play I would only have shoving range with a <15bb stack and it depends a lot how aggressive the players behind you are how wide you can shove. ICM is also a factor. Especially in a STT SNG and final table.

You can use a simple hand chart for stealing, mostly on middle stages and beyond (PS actually have nice charts for your status, a pretty detailed one).
Under 13-15 blinds you should shove/re-steal all-in or fold; min-raise when you have 20-25+ blinds.
Any ICM software is good for finding out where and when, SNG wizard, ICMizer etc.
Calculating yourself these things is not applicable real time because of vastly different situations (stack distribution, calling ranges etc.) and because the calculations are very lengthy.
